In our second Women in Mobility, The Ways We Move, speaks to Professor Sarah Nilsson — aviation attorney and faculty at Embry-Riddle Aeronautical University—to talk about her inspiring career in both conventional aviation and the emerging Advanced Air Mobility (AAM) industry.

Sarah shares her journey as a woman navigating and leading in a historically male-dominated field, as well as her insights on how aviation law is evolving to meet the needs of new technologies like eVTOLs, UAM, and electric aviation.

In This Episode:

  • What it takes to thrive in aviation law and academia
  • The legal challenges facing AAM integration
  • How to foster diversity and inclusion in the aviation industry
